Tips for a successful application
We cannot guarantee that your application will be accepted but here are some tips to help you along the way and give your application the best chance...
- Young people should be involved at every stage of the application process.
- The project must meet one of the five Every Child Matters outcomes and one or more of the local priorities that are explained in the application pack.
- The project should promote active involvement in your neighbourhood / community.
- You can send in CDs, DVDs, film and photographs to support your application.
- Funds should have the maximum impact on the maximum number of young people possible. However, if your project deals with small numbers of people it will not be excluded and you must explain why your project will work with small numbers.
- Think of what you want to achieve and how it will make a difference to people's lives.
- Think about what your project will cost and give realistic estimates for all expenditure.
- If you have applied for funding elsewhere or tried to raise your own funds this will be viewed favourably.
- Think about how you will evaluate how successful your project has been.
We also advise that you fully read the guidance notes (which can be found in the application pack) before completing your application form. These will make completing the form much easier and ensure that you complete each section correctly.
